Rolls-Royce Half-Year Update Summary
Financials:
Strong performance with profit and cash flow growth.
Full-year guidance remains unchanged.
Improved credit ratings and a stronger balance sheet.
Civil Aerospace:
Engine flying hours are recovering well, nearing 2019 levels.
New orders secured from VietJet, Starlux, and IndiGo.
Investments made to meet rising maintenance needs.
Defence:
Contract wins for the AUKUS submarine program and B-52 engine program.
Positive progress on the Global Combat Air Programme.
Power Systems:
Growth in data center and government applications markets.
New order for battery energy storage solution in Latvia.
Sale of lower-power engines business to Deutz on track.
Transformation:
On track to deliver ยฃ200 million in annual savings by 2025.
Implementing a simpler and more focused organizational structure.
Building a "One Rolls-Royce" culture for long-term success.
Next Steps:
Half-year results announcement on August 1, 2024.
